Output df0a53bd11b8c44ef5823d3af23414d080de8e23386495744df74aa531cf51f9:9

value
2514921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870209afa2e33a62401033502c31ec43aa78b094 OP_EQUAL
address
3Dzsb2pbGfijNaAqiVgcDcc2uKaQyVsBDN
transaction
df0a53bd11b8c44ef5823d3af23414d080de8e23386495744df74aa531cf51f9
confirmations
348682
spent
true